Pryor’s humid subtropical summers drive centipedes and millipedes indoors through foundation cracks and crawlspace vents, especially in older housing stock around Downtown Pryor and East Pryor. These arthropods follow moisture trails from Pryor Creek and nearby golf course irrigation, entering via unsealed sill plates and utility penetrations common in homes built before modern vapor barriers. Perimeter sprays alone often fail when interior humidity stays high, so treatments combine exterior barriers with targeted moisture reduction at entry points.

In Mayes County, mild winters allow overwintering populations to rebound quickly once spring rains hit, making spring and fall the peak service windows. Technicians inspect under porches and along slab edges where leaf litter collects against siding, then apply gel baits and dusts in voids rather than broad sprays that wash away during sudden thunderstorms. Homeowners near Vinita or Catoosa roads see similar patterns when drainage ditches feed extra moisture toward foundations.

Treatments must account for pets and children, so products are chosen for low volatility and applied only to cracks and harborages. Follow-up visits check for re-entry at weep holes and expansion joints that shift with Oklahoma’s freeze-thaw cycles. Addressing the moisture source, such as grading soil away from the foundation or sealing sump lids, prevents repeat calls that pure pesticide applications cannot solve.

+ Why do centipedes and millipedes keep returning in Pryor homes?
High summer humidity and mild winters in Mayes County allow populations to persist; sealing moisture sources matters more than repeated spraying.
+ Is treatment safe around children and pets?
Products are applied only inside cracks and voids with low-volatility formulas; residents can return once the application dries, usually within an hour.
+ How soon will I see results after service?
Most activity drops within 48 hours, with full control confirmed at the follow-up visit 14 to 21 days later.
+ Do I need ongoing service every year?
Many East Pryor and Downtown properties need only one treatment plus moisture fixes; annual visits are recommended only when crawlspaces stay damp.
